The global airplane machmeters market was valued at USD 68.54 million in 2023 and is estimated to reach approximately USD 128.75 million by 2032, at a CAGR of 7.2% from 2024 to 2032.

The development of aircraft machmeters represents a significant breakthrough in aviation equipment. These advanced instruments calculate the speed of an aircraft about the speed of sound, giving pilots vital information they need to maintain safe and ideal flying conditions. Machmeters are equipped with state-of-the-art technology that provides accurate readings in real-time, improving navigation and flight control. Machmeters transform flight operations with their accuracy and dependability, empowering pilots to navigate successfully and adapt to changing flight conditions. This invention highlights the aviation industry',s dedication to ongoing safety standards development and represents a substantial technological advancement.

Based on type, the global airplane machmeters market is divided into analog type and digital type. The digital type category dominates the market with the largest revenue share in 2023. Digital machmeters show airspeed data using digital displays, like LCD or LED panels. Compared to analog counterparts, they provide many benefits, such as improved accuracy, flexibility, and integration potential. Beyond just velocity, digital machmeters can show other aircraft characteristics like heading, altitude, and navigation data. Analog machmeters show airspeed data using conventional analog gauges. Usually, they are made up of a mechanical needle or pointer that indicates the speed of the aircraft by moving along a scale.

Based on the application, the global airplane machmeters market is categorized as military aircraft, commercial aircraft, business jets, and civil aviation. The commercial aircraft category leads the global airplane machmeters market with the largest revenue share in 2023. Airlines operate passenger airliners with commercial aircraft machmeters equipped for the purpose of transporting both passengers and cargo. For commercial airplanes to operate safely and effectively, machmeters are essential.

Military aircraft are equipped with machmeters to meet defense forces', requirements. These aircraft include of military transports, fighter jets, helicopters, and reconnaissance aircraft. Business jet machmeters are designed specifically for corporate and executive travel. Business travelers, VIPs, and charter services use these planes for private aviation. In civil aviation, machmeters refer to a wide variety of aircraft that are utilized for aerial firefighting, general aviation, training, and air ambulance services, among other uses.
